What are science points in ksp2? ›

Science points are gained from performing experiments using science collection modules in various orbital situations and on surface regions. They are also rewarded for completing primary or secondary missions assigned by Mission Control.

How accurate is Kerbal Space Program? ›

Physics. While the game is not a perfect simulation of reality, it has been praised for its largely accurate orbital mechanics; all objects in the game except the celestial bodies are simulated using Newtonian dynamics.

Is it worth transmitting data ksp? ›

Science must either be recovered or transmitted in order to be used on Kerbin to unlock additional technologies. While transmission is generally not for 100% value, experiments may be repeated and retransmitted, often gaining more science value than the transmit window shows.

Is KSP physics good? ›

The solar system depicted in the game is around 1/10th the scale of our own. The physics are limited in a way so that lagrange points don't function in the game. But real physics formulas for gravity and forces do apply. A knowledge of physics will help you play the game, but aren't required.

Does KSP2 have science mode? ›

The For Science! Update added a revamped Science mode from KSP to KSP2 called Exploration mode. There are new science gathering parts, re-entry heating, new KSP 2 Discoverables found all throughout the Kerbol System and small differences from KSP1's Science mode for improved user experience.
